A man has been charged with murdering his own father in Wendover, a leafy suburb on the edge of the Chilterns.
Courtney Bamford, aged 36, who was living in a hostel in Griffin Lane, Aylesbury, is accused of killing his 77-year-old father John Bamford at his £555,000 Buckinghamshire home.
Police and ambulance crews were called to the three-bedroomed semi-detached house at twenty past five in the afternoon following reports of an assault.
Courtney Bamford has been remanded in custody to appear at Oxford Magistrates’ Court on Saturday, April 10
